Transaction 64de78f3464730024e380b21b2da3b020dab16785a2c8d0cbbbd12efe7664831

3 Input
2 Outputs
  • 64de78f3464730024e380b21b2da3b020dab16785a2c8d0cbbbd12efe7664831:0
  • value  1002118
    address  35MbHPxS7SCSJ3zfTLT4fd8DkRjYBgGsjM
  • 64de78f3464730024e380b21b2da3b020dab16785a2c8d0cbbbd12efe7664831:1
  • value  10740
    address  3HhsHUR4mzVPBZJbxmMKJtPWrzNxGFVBNj